Light herbaceous and mineral notes on the nose, light yellow spice, citrus and stone fruit aromas, peppery traces. Fairly firm, partly candied, fairly sweet fruit on the palate, lively acidity, vegetal, herbaceous and floral notes, slightly spicy and creamy, good persistence, mineral notes in the background, good to very good juicy, spicy, sweetish finish. Does not really need the residual sugar.
